Bridging Technology and Education
A lifelong tech enthusiast (programming, Raspberry Pis!), my passion led me to a First Class Honours Higher Diploma in Software Development. While industry experience as a developer/tester was valuable, my true calling emerged at the intersection of technology and pedagogy. To bridge these, I earned my UK QTS via Moreland University, transitioning to teach Computer Science internationally in 2019. Since then, I've focused on developing robust CS curricula (KS3-IBDP) and embracing school-wide EdTech leadership.
